Four Seasons Hotel Hong Kong Achieves a Recording-breaking 6 Five Star Ratings with Forbes Travel Guide 2022 Star Awards

April 27, 2022 by StrawberrY Gal

 Four Seasons Hotel Hong Kong today celebrates a new record as Forbes Travel Guide unveiled its 2022 Star Awards results on April 26, 2022. In the 64th edition of the annual list, Four Seasons Hotel Hong Kong brought home a total of 30 Stars across the Hotel, Spa, and all four restaurants, with Sushi Saito and Tempura Uchitsu now joining Lung King Heen and Caprice on the Five Star list. It is a testament to Four Seasons ongoing commitment to elevating the guest experience and investing in an unparalleled product offering to meet the needs of today’s luxury traveller.

Jens Wycisk, Hotel Manager at Four Seasons Hotel Hong Kong, expresses pride in his team: “Forbes Travel Guide is one of the most prestigious global rating systems for luxury hotels, restaurants and spas. To be recognized with 6 Five Star ratings demonstrate the Hotel’s longstanding commitment to exemplary service. It’s a huge achievement for one single hotel property to earn a total of 30 Stars. The recognition reflects the dedication of our teams in pursuing excellence in every aspect.”

Located in the heart of Central, Four Seasons Hotel Hong Kong has recently completed a transformation, and offers guests an elevated experience with a set of completely redesigned guest rooms and suites that embodies a sense of unique modernism and tradition. The staying experience is completed with a curated list of holistic treatments at The Spa and a collection of remarkable cuisines at its restaurants.

Four Seasons Hotel Hong Kong has earned Five Star rating across the following categories:

Property: Four Seasons Hotel Hong Kong

Spa: The Spa at Four Seasons

Restaurant: Lung King Heen

Restaurant: Caprice

Restaurant: Sushi Saito

Restaurant: Tempura Uchitsu
